Transaction 3175984ea0ffa84b28a41be156999149e185a22eed4f55cb6c264f54c316bd6d
1 Input
1 Output
-
3175984ea0ffa84b28a41be156999149e185a22eed4f55cb6c264f54c316bd6d:0
- value
- 118812
- script pubkey
- OP_0 OP_PUSHBYTES_20 84c2c0c02db18771d858b5f65f44f169cdf342f8
- address
- bc1qsnpvpspdkxrhrkzckhm97383d8xlxshc5zzg4n